Transaction 95c78aef11d77bf321b9ab4cd354bd27e560c5bbb3ab7694805aff33ba43202b
1 Input
1 Output
-
95c78aef11d77bf321b9ab4cd354bd27e560c5bbb3ab7694805aff33ba43202b:0
- value
- 513262
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57ecbf40a3c34b0a48c142c852d8171f3a18a2d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 191uQAZDSwMbC88Z5nnGoR3rnzfmNi6Std